I've owned this record since new in the 1960s and have played it carefully. Whilst not being an expert in grading LPs, I would say that it plays as well as some Ex graded records I have bought on eBay, certainly VG+ with minimal crackling on needle run-in and no crackling that I can hear during playback. For me, it seems to play just as well as when I first played it about 50 years ago. The sleeve is also in good condition with minimal wear on the corners but slight yellowing on the white area of the front cover. All seams are sound and the album title is clearly displayed on the spine. Also included is the original Blue Note characterised inner paper sleeve in reasonably good condition. If you've read this far you'll probably already know that it is Herbie Hancock's debut album described as "one of the most accomplished and stunning debuts in the annals of jazz" and including "Watermelon Man"
